Tigers Preview: Will the Tigers Come Through as Road Favorites?

Texas Southern Tigers Recent Game/Games

Texas Southern picked up their first win of the season on Monday, January 6th, with a 71-66 victory over Grambling State. The win came at home and improved their record to 1-11.

Texas Southern led 32-30 at halftime and held on for the win, scoring 25 points in the 2nd half while allowing 27. They were -4 favorites going into the game and covered the spread. The total points for the game were 137, just over the O/U line of 136.5.

Tigers Offense Breakdown

Texas Southern's offense put up 71 points in their last game, shooting 39.4% from the field and 33.3% from beyond the arc. Their effective field goal percentage was 45.5%, and they connected on 78.6% of their free throws, going 11-for-14 from the line.

Zaire Hayes led the way with 24 points, hitting 3-of-7 from deep and shooting 53.3% overall. Antwan Burnett and Ernest Ross each added 13 points, with Burnett grabbing 8 rebounds and shooting 55.6% from the field.

Tigers Team Defense

Texas Southern held their opponent to 66 points, allowing them to shoot 39% from the field on 26 of 66 attempts. Inside the arc, the Tigers gave up 18 two-point baskets on 42 tries, a 42% shooting rate.

From three-point range, Texas Southern's defense conceded 8 threes on 24 attempts, with their opponent shooting 33%. They also sent them to the free-throw line 14 times, where they converted 11 for 78%. Texas Southern allowed 7 offensive rebounds.

Delta Devils Preview: Will the Delta Devils Exceed Expectations at Home?

The Delta Devils’ season continued its rough start with a 74-65 loss to Prairie View A&M on Saturday, dropping them to 0-14. Despite being +13.5 underdogs, they kept the game closer than expected.

After trailing 39-26 at halftime, Mississippi Valley State showed some fight, outscoring Prairie View A&M 39-35 in the second half. The game’s total points of 139 fell short of the 144.5 O/U line.

Delta Devils Offense Breakdown

In their last game, Mississippi Valley State put up 65 points, shooting 45.3% from the field and 33.3% from beyond the arc. Their effective field goal percentage was 49.1%, and they connected on 70.6% of their free throws, going 12-for-17 from the line.

Tanahj Pettway led the Delta Devils with 22 points, while Marcel Bryant and Jordan Tillmon each added 18. Jair Horton was efficient, shooting 77.8% from the field and hitting 2-of-3 from three-point range.

Delta Devils Team Defense

Mississippi Valley State's defense gave up 74 points in their last game, with the opposing team shooting 45% from the field, hitting 24 of 53 attempts. Inside the arc, they allowed 19 two-point baskets on 38 tries, a 50% success rate.

From three-point range, the Delta Devils' defense held the other team to 5 made threes on 15 attempts, a 33% shooting performance. They also sent the opposition to the free-throw line 17 times, where they converted 12, shooting 70%. Mississippi Valley State allowed 10 offensive rebounds.
